Operating fault messages
  These  appear  with  the ©  warning  light  and  mean  that  you  should  drive  very  carefully  to  an  authorised  dealer  as 
soon as possible. If you fail to follow this recommendation, you risk damaging your vehicle.
They disappear when the display selection key is pressed or after several seconds and are stored in the computer log. The 
© 
warning light stays on. Examples of operating fault messages are given in the following pages.
Examples of messages Interpretation of messages
“check vehicle” Indicates  a  fault  in  one  of  the  pedal  sensors,  battery  management  system  or  oil 
level sensor.
“check power steering” Indicates a fault in the power-assisted steering system.
“check parking brake” Indicates a fault on the parking brake.
“check exhaust emission” Indicates a fault in the vehicle’s particle filter system.
“check 4Wd” Indicates a fault in the vehicle’s all-wheel drive (4WD) transmission system.
“check airbag” Indicates a fault in the air bag system (air bag, pretensioners, etc.).

Parking sensor
Operating principle
On  equipped  vehicles,  ultrasonic  sen -
sors  fitted  in  the  vehicle’s  rear  and/or 
front  bumper  measure  the  distance 
between  the  vehicle  and  an  obstacle 
when reversing.
This  measurement  is  indicated  by 
beeps which become more frequent the 
closer  you  come  to  the  obstacle,  until 
they  become  a  continuous  beep  when 
the  vehicle  is  approximately  25  centi -
metres from the obstacle.
Special features
Ensure  that  the  ultrasonic  sensors  are 
not obscured (by dirt, mud, snow, etc.).
This function is an additional aid that indicates the distance between the 
vehicle and an obstacle whilst reversing, using sound signals.
Under no circumstances should it replace the driver’s care or responsibil -
ity whilst reversing.
The  driver  should  always  look  out  for  sudden  hazards  during  driving:  always 
ensure  that  there  are  no  moving  obstacles  (such  as  a  child,  animal,  pram  or  bi-
cycle,  etc.)  or  small,  narrow  objects  such  as  stones  or  posts  in  your  path  when 
manoeuvring.
PARKING DISTANCE CONTROL (1/3)
Front parking distance 
control
(Depending on the vehicle)
Operation
when  moving  forwards   at  less  than 
7   mph  (12  km/h),  when  any  object 
is  detected  less  than  approximately 
1 metre  from  the  front  of  the  vehicle:  a 
beep sounds.
Automatic activation/deactivation of 
front parking distance control
The system deactivates:
–  when the vehicle speed is above ap-
proximately 7 mph (12 km/h);
–  When  the  vehicle  is  stationary  for 
more than three seconds: only in the 
case that the vehicle speed dropped 
from  above  approximately  7  mph 
(12  km/h)  and  an  obstacle  is  more 
than  30  centimetres  away  from  the 
vehicle (e.g., traffic jam);
–  when  the  vehicle  is  in  neutral  or 
when the gear lever has been shifted 
to N or P for automatic gearboxes.

Temporary activation/deactivation
Press  switch  1   to  deactivate  the 
system: the indicator light on the switch 
comes  on  and  the  message  “ Parking 
sensor  off ”  is  displayed  on  the  instru -
ment panel.
The  system  is  reactivated  by  pressing 
the switch.
Note:   in  this  case,  the  system  is  au -
tomatically  reactivated  each  time  the 
engine is switched off.
1
Activating/deactivating for long 
periods
Press  the  switch  for  approximately 
3 seconds to deactivate the system: the 
indicator  light  on  the  switch  comes  on 
and  the  message  “ Parking  sensor  off” 
is displayed on the instrument panel.
The  system  is  reactivated  by  press -
ing  the  switch  again  for  approximately 
3 seconds.
Operating faultsWhen  the  system  detects  an  operat -
ing  fault,  the  message  “ Check  parking 
sensor ”  is  displayed  on  the  instrument 
panel,  the  
© warning  light  comes 
on and a beep sounds.
Consult an approved Dealer.
When  the  vehicle  is  being  driven 
at  a  speed  below  7  mph  (12  km/h), 
certain  noises  (motorcycle,  lorry, 
pneumatic drill, rain, alarm etc.) may 
trigger the beeping sound.

Under  the  following  conditions,  the 
parking  distance  control  system 
may not function:
–  the  sensors  are  obscured  (dirt, 
mud, snow, etc.);
Clean with a soft cloth.
–  the sensors are frozen.
Under  the  following  conditions,  the 
parking  distance  control  system  
may malfunction:
–  uneven surface, gravel track, hill, 
forest track, etc.
–  floods or water splashes.
The  system  may  not  detect  objects 
such as the following:
–  narrow  obstacles  (sharp-edged 
objects or rope);
–  materials  which  absorb  sound 
waves  easily  (cotton,  sponge, 
snow, etc.)
